Capes hurls no-hitter against Aggies

By Joshua Price/Sports Editor

Etowah High School sophomore Dylan Capes pitched five innings of no-hit baseball as the Blue Devils defeated Albertville High School in Junior Varsity action on March 27, 11-0.

Capes allowed the Aggies only two base runners during the match – the first on a walk and the second on a fielding error. Capes struck out seven batters to earn the win. 

“I am proud of the way Dylan pitched,” Etowah head coach Kevin Horton said. “He works hard everyday in practice so this performance really doesn’t surprise me that much. He has pitched great for us all year and he always gives us a chance to win. We expect a lot out of him in the future here.”
